Contests

LISTEN LIVE

Dean DeLeo

MusicStone Temple Pilots Guitarist Dean DeLeo Unveils Solo Album With Pete Shoulder

Guitar master Dean DeLeo stepped away from Stone Temple Pilots to be part of One More Satellite. This new band releases a self-titled album on July 18 through Symphonic Records….

Laura Adkins